解题思路:把输入的数字当做字符串处理后再输出。
注意事项:注意字符串末尾‘\0’;
参考代码:
#include<string.h> #include<stdio.h> char* Function(char *p1,char const *p2) { char* ret = p1; int i = 1; while (*p2) { if (i) { *p1++ = *p2++; i = 0; } else { *p1++ = ' '; i = 1; } } *p1 = '\0'; return ret; } int main(int argc, char** argv) { char c1[100],c2[100]; gets(c1); puts(Function(c2,c1)); return 0; }
0.0分
2 人评分
妹子杀手的故事 (C语言代码)浏览:1230 |
C语言程序设计教程(第三版)课后习题6.8 (C语言代码)浏览:527 |
母牛的故事 (C语言代码)浏览:1428 |
矩阵加法 (C语言代码)浏览:1722 |
1050题解(结构体数组与结构体指针的使用)浏览:1108 |
C语言程序设计教程(第三版)课后习题11.1 (C语言代码)浏览:488 |
分糖果 (C语言代码)浏览:920 |
数组输出 (C语言代码)浏览:703 |
C语言训练-自守数问题 (C语言代码)浏览:748 |
【出圈】 (C++代码)简单循环浏览:639 |